The Orphanage (2007), shot by Óscar Faura, runs heavily desaturated and balanced, measured across 64 sampled frames. Its two dominant hue families are cyan and blue. The single most common colour is dark grey (#2d312e), covering 13.4% of sampled colour. Overall the image sits mid-key.
